Q:   Which entrance exam is required for admissions to BE courses at Easa College of Engineering?
A: 

No, for admissions to BE courses at Easa College of Engineering, entrance exam scores are not compulsory. The college accepts students according to their Class 12 scores, and cutoff scores acheived in TNEA counselling. One should know, to calculate the TNEA cutoff, the formula used by authorities is: Maths + (Physics/ 2) + (Chemistry/2), where the scores of each subject are out of 200. 

 

 

 

Q:   Can I take admission to the Punjabi University BTech without JEE Mains?
A: 

No, candidates are not allowed to get admission into Punjabi University without JEE Mains scores. The eligibility requirement candidates are required to complete for admission to the BTech course is Class 12 or equivalent with Physics, Chemistry, Mathematics, and English as their subjects with a minimum of 50% aggregate (for General Category). Moreover, appearing and securing valid scores in JEE Mains is a must.

Q:   What is the fee for BTech at KJ College of Engineering?
A: 

Fee for BTech programme at KJ College of Engineering is different for different category of students. First year fee for Open Category students is INR 90,000 while for OBC male and OBC female is INR 53,985 and INR 11,790 respectively.

Q:   Is it difficult to get into Uka Tarsadia University BTech?
A: 

No, it is not difficult to get into Uka Tarsadia University BTech as their multiple ways one can get into the programme. Uka Tarsadia University BTech admissions take place through the JEE Mains and GUJCET entrance exam. If a candidate has a valid JEE Mains or a GUJCET score they are eligible to apply for admission in the BTech programme.

The GUJCET exam is not as tough as other national-level entrance exams in the country, as the competition is much less than other exams. Thus, it is not very difficult to get into Uka Tarsadia University BTech.

Q:   What is the eligibility criteria for admissions to BTech courses at Saveetha University?
A: 

The eligibility requirements for admission to BTech/ BE courses at Saveetha University are candidates must qualify their Class 12 from PCM stream with a minimum of 45%. Additionally, for the selection process, eligible candidates must achieve the required scores in the Saveetha University in-house entrance exam followed by counselling. Moreover, the university also grants admission based on TNEA Counselling.
